Output 025d669b7c36200264ec749b4a477fbf766281bc453c4cbf3359a5161fbc21aa:10

value
308531956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56dacac630fcbd7fee424c22b49b9709dde3ef80 OP_EQUAL
address
MFpQSsKC5FvhkL1h2jm4eFdnbEyQzfjvbC
transaction
025d669b7c36200264ec749b4a477fbf766281bc453c4cbf3359a5161fbc21aa
spent
true